1. 什么是v2ray和vmess
V2Ray 是一个优秀的开源网络代理工具,可以帮助用户进行科学上网。VMess 是V2Ray的一种传输协议,用于和服务器进行通信。
2. v2ray安装
安装v2ray有多种方法,包括使用脚本安装和手动安装。这里我们介绍使用脚本安装的方法。
# 下载并运行安装脚本
wget https://install.direct/go.sh
sudo bash go.sh
安装完成后,v2ray会自动运行,并会生成相应的配置文件。
3. 配置vmess
3.1 服务器端配置
在服务器端,编辑/etc/v2ray/config.json文件,添加以下内容:
{
  "inbounds": [
    {
      "port": 10000,  # 服务器端口
      "protocol": "vmess",  # 传输协议
      "settings": {
        "clients": [
          {
            "id": "UUID",  # 客户端ID
            "alterId": 64
          }
        ]
      }
    }
  ],
  "outbounds": ...
}
3.2 客户端配置
在客户端,编辑v2ray配置文件,添加以下内容:
{
  "inbounds": ...
  "outbounds": [
    {
      "protocol": "vmess",
      "settings": {
        "vnext": [
          {
            "address": "服务器IP",  # 服务器地址
            "port": 10000,  # 服务器端口
            "users": [
              {
                "id": "UUID",  # 服务器端ID
                "alterId": 64
              }
            ]
          }
        ]
      },
      "streamSettings": ...
    }
  ]
}
4. 常见问题解答
4.1 如何解决连接问题?
- 确保服务器端口已开放
- 检查防火墙设置
- 检查客户端配置是否正确
4.2 如何更改vmess的UUID?
- 在服务器端和客户端配置文件中修改id字段的值
4.3 如何优化v2ray性能?
- 使用CDN加速
- 调整传输协议和加密方式
以上是关于v2ray配置vmess的详细教程及常见问题解答,希望可以帮助到您。
正文完
                                                
                    